We recently traded our 2014 Jeep Grand Cherokee Ecodiesel for a 2023 Ram Laramie 4x4 Hemi/Etorque. We got a great deal. Sticker was $72k plus; we purchased for $58k. The Ecodiesel was a great powerplant, but also the most expensive engine to maintain of any Ram, including the 2500 and 3500 Cummins Turbodiesels. We never had a problem with our engine, but so many owners suffered serious problems, forcing Stellantis to discontinue selling the Ecodiesel in the U.S. The other problem with diesels in these pickups is the price of diesel fuel compared to gasoline, and the fact that you have to add the cost of diesel exhaust fluid (DEF) to every fill up. There will also be periodic Diesel Particulate Filter (DPF) regeneration cycles to contend with, which will require you to drive for 15-20 minutes at highway speeds in order to clean the DPF.

    Your ram truck probably has the towing package with the 3.92 rear end and higher payload capacity. This particular truck does not. Remember, your payload is a major factor on how much you can tow. So if your truck has a 12,000 lb towing capacity and only a 1500 lb payload capacity. That mean’s your trailer’s tongue weight is gonna be 1200 lbs plus 300 lbs of payload (driver, passengers, stuff). Has nothing to do with pulling power. Besides, you can get the max towing package for the diesel, which upgrades to a 3.73 gear ratio in a 9.75” rear axle, bigger brakes, and thicker frame…all which bumps it to over 12k lbs. If you’re gonna be regularly towing over 10k lbs, I’d advise to jump into a 3/4 ton.
